4. Identify the term with coefficient -3 in the expression:<br> 9a3 + 4b2 - 3c + 11
Mrrafil [7]

Answer:

-3 is the coefficient of c.

Step-by-step explanation:

The given expression is :

9a³ + 4b² - 3c + 11

We need to find the term with coefficient -3 in the expression.

The coefficient is defined as a number or quantity placed with a variable.

The coefficient of a³ = 9

The coefficient of b² = 4

The coefficient of c = -3

Hence, -3 is the coefficient of c.
